She’s generated enough good will with us lately on the style front, what with all her fierceness and prettiness getting the spotlight it so deserves, that we’re willing to cut some slack for a dress we don’t much like.
Jada Pinkett Smith attends the premiere of “Magic Mike XXL” in Amsterdam, Netherlands in a Versace gown paired with Monica Vinader jewelry and Ruthie Davis ‘Estelle’ heels.
It’s striking, and the pinks really flatter her (although we’re not crazy about the ombre effect here), but we just can’t with the sheer skirts, even if they do remind us of ’80s video games.
But since she’s been killing it on the Magic Mike poledance like no one else in that cast, we can’t hate. It’s not boring. That’s enough.
